Avengers vol. 3 #75

Title: "The Search for She-Hulk part 4: ‘With Friends Like These…’”

Writer: Geoff Johns

Penciller: Scott Kolins

Inker: Scott Kolins

Colors: Chris Sotomayor

Editor: Tom Brevoort

Hulk hits She-Hulk and tells her to do what he says and go away. She-Hulk hits back, drawing Hulk’s blood, and says that she was there first. Hawkeye is sent flying at the fight continues. Hulk says that there are no girls allowed. Hawkeye says that maybe this wasn’t such a good idea. Captain America grabs Hawkeye’s hand. Cap asks what wasn’t such a good idea. Hawkeye asks where Thor is. Cap says that he is no longer an Avenger. Hawkeye says that they need Hercules, Wonder Man, or some big gun. Cap says that they already got them. Iron Man and Wanda fly down. Wanda says that this is a pleasant surprise. Iron Man asks Hawkeye what he did.

She-Hulk smashes a tree into Hulk’s chest. The tree shatters.

Hawkeye says that he did what he had to do. He says that he brought Hulk out to keep Jen busy. He says that she wanted to go fight the Hulkbusters and turn the town into a cemetery. The Hulk/She-Hulk fight creates some kind of sonic boom from the collision. Iron Man says that as if She-Hulk wasn’t bad enough on her own. Hawkeye tells him to lighten up, and that he is sure Cap already has a dozen different ways to stop them. He says that he bets even Shellhead has one. Iron Man says that he does, but that it is risky. Hawkeye asks if it is as risky as revealing his secret identity. Iron Man looks at Hawkeye smirking and radios Ant-Man.

Ant-Man tells Iron Man that he is hearing him and to go ahead. Iron Man says that they need Jack of Hearts out there immediately. He says that things with the She-Hulk just took at turn for the worse. He says that they got some “assistance” from Hawkeye. Ant-Man starts to ask what he is doing there, but Iron Man tells him to focus and shows him what they are dealing with. Ant-Man sees Hulk and She-Hulk fighting. Ant-Man asks what Iron Man wants him to do. Iron Man says that he needs him to get Jack out of the Zero Room and fly him out there fast. He says that they will debrief him on the way. Ant-Man says that the time lock isn’t going to open for twelve hours. Iron Man tells him to figure out another way to open it then. Ant-Man starts talking about how impossible it is, but Iron Man says that Ant-Man was a burglar at one point, and to get to it. Iron Man signs off. Scott says that he hopes picking locks is like riding a bike.

Hulk and She-Hulk are charging at one another with giant rocks. Wanda hexes and changes the ice and snow into steam. She says that it should confuse them for a moment. Wanda says that she thinks that she broke her wrist, but that she has to keep them apart. She says that Jen is strong, but that she is no match for the Hulk.

Hawkeye and Cap are talking strategy when Hulk comes up behind them. Hulk says, “Avengers.” He tries to hit them with a tree, but they dodge out of the way. Hawkeye tells Hulk that he has to close his eyes and count to ten first in tag. Hawkeye fires arrows at Hulk’s eyes, but they break against them. One of Hawkeye’s arrows hit Cap in the shoulder, but when Hawk points it out to Cap he says that they will take care of it after. Cap throws his shield at Hulk, but Hulk just catches it.

Ant-Man shrinks down into the time lock with a paperclip in his hand. He sees the three movement mechanical system and figures out that he has to fool three clocks into thinking that fourteen hours have passed. He enters the code and unlocks the standard mechanism. He walks from the locking rod to the clocks. He says that they have to fool all three clocks at the same time and asks his ant friends if they are ready. The lock shorts out and falls to the floor. The Zero Room door blows off. Ant-Man helps Jack to his feet and tells him to wake up. Jack says that his cells aren’t drained yet. He says that his skin is on fire and that he shouldn’t be out. Jack asks what time it is. Scott says that it is time to suit up and that he has a job to do.

Sheryl tells Doc Samson that he doesn’t care what kind of doctor he is or what kind of army they are. She says that the Avengers told her that they would stop this, and that they won’t use missiles to destroy more of their homes. Lance says that they will have to go through them to get to them. Samson says that he will give them their chance. He tells the troops to hold their ground. He says that he hopes Banner doesn’t sneak away from them this time.

She-Hulk comes over the top of a ridge. Wanda and Iron Man call out to ‘Jennifer’, but She-Hulk just smashes Iron Man. Iron Man says that the battle has regressed her even further. He says that half his systems just went off-line. He says that he can still fly them out of there. Tony realizes that he just lost a tooth.

Iron Man tries to radio Cap, but the interference scrambles the reception. Hulk throws the shield. Cap bounces off some trees and catches the shield in mid-air. Hawkeye asks how he did that. Cap says that it is just practice like Hawkeye does. She-Hulk leaps onto Hulk.

Jack of Hearts arrives in Bone Idaho. He swears to Cap that he didn’t mean to do this. Cap says that they all know. Cap asks Jack if he thinks he can perform a limited detonation and then retain the fallout. Jack says that he was only in the Zero Room for a few hours and that he can feel his suit burning off. He says that he is close to blacking out. He says that he isn’t sure that he is going to be able to reabsorb it. He says that he could turn the entire town into a desert and wind up killing She-Hulk. He says that maybe he should just fly away. Iron Man radios Jack. He says that he knows that the last few months, and years, have been hard, but that he has come a long way since he first got into this game. Iron Man says that this is a big step and that he has to trust himself. Jack tells Mr. Stark to get everyone clear. Iron Man flies away holding Wanda, Cap, and Hawkeye. Jack dives to the ground and explodes. He pulls the radiation back in. Bruce Banner and Jennifer Walters lie on the ground unconscious. Jack says, “I’m… sorry.” He holds his hand out to Jen and turns her back into the She-Hulk.

Iron Man says that the radioactive levels are falling to near zero. He says that Jack did it.

Bruce gets up. He checks She-Hulk’s pulse. He says that she is better off with them, and that he is better off leaving.

She-Hulk wakes up and calls out to Bruce. Cap, Iron Man, Wanda, and Hawkeye stand looking down on her. Cap welcomes her back. Ant-Man says that he can’t believe Jack pulled it off as they’re loading Jack into a containment unit. She-Hulk asks if he is going to be all right. Iron Man says that he isn’t sure, and that Jack has never done anything like this before. Jen goes to check on him, but Iron Man tells her to stay back and that he would hate to have to start the cycle over again. She-Hulk looks at Jack and asks how he returned her to her normal self. Tony says that Jack can see radiation the way they see colors. He says that he must have recharged her to her proper dose of gamma radiation. Stark says that they can’t risk having the two of them come in contact with one another. She-Hulk asks how they’re going to make sure. Iron Man says that one of them will have to leave the team. She-Hulk calls to Hawkeye. She lifts him off the air and says that this is for helping him. She kisses him. She says that this is for shooting her cousin with an arrow. She throws him into some fallen trees. Hawkeye says that he has missed her. Wanda asks if Clint is back then. Hawkeye says that he is back.

Cap looks over the destruction. She-Hulk says that she did all that. She asks how many there are. Cap says that there are 72 injured, but that there are no deaths. He adds that Stark already has his company headed out to rebuild the town. He says that it will take time, and that maybe some of the wounds will never help. Cap says that the media is blaming the Hulk. She-Hulk tries to object, but Cap tells her to let them say what they want. A tear rolls down Jen’s cheek. She says that she doesn’t know if she can forgive herself for this. Cap says that the Avengers will help her and this town the best they can. Jen asks how Bruce does it. She wonders how he deals with the pain, fear, and guilt. Cap says, “Alone?” The helicopters fly away. Cap says that he will never know, and that neither will She-Hulk. They get on the quinjet.

Bruce walks down the street alone.

Avengers Files rating: 7 out of 10

It’s cool to have Hulk and She-Hulk fighting one another, but this wasn’t really the battle I was hoping for. Hulk and She-Hulk never really go at one another. Jack’s “sacrifice” was a nice wrap to the storyline, but if it comes down to She-Hulk or Jack on the team… well its been nice Jack. Shortly after the release of this issue there was news made regarding the upcoming She-Hulk series. If you’re a fan of She-Hulk you have to buy the book. Even if you don’t like it. Remember Marvel won’t look for another creative team instead of just canceling it unless it’s a success first. Kolins does okay, but his Hawkeye still looks lousy to me. Most of his Hulk looked pretty good. 3 out of 5 for art.
